  5. oh ya, about the new ruling on Petrol, only allow 20 litres on the way back to Singapore. At the JB Petrol Kiosk, the Kiosk attendant will asked you to pay for 20 litres of Petrol at the office counter first. After that, then pump petrol, if your car cannot consume the 20 litres, it will then refund you the balance $$$…..very “susah” mana ada system????
